The course provides you with the opportunity to gain experience and obtain a vocationally related qualification (VRQ) Level 3 in Hairdressing. This is a professional qualification that covers all aspects of hairdressing with a heavy emphasis on colour correction. This is a comprehensive and demanding course. This course will be delivered at The Lanes campus in Brentwood.

Course information

Name: HAIRDRESSING LEVEL 3 DIPLOMA FOR COLOUR TECHNICIANS Qualification title: Diploma in Hairdressing for Colour Technicians (QCF) Qualification type: Assessment Assessments are continuous throughout the year. You will be required to produce a portfolio containing evidence of practical and theory work. You will also be required to have a salon placement alongside the course. You will also need to complete online exams for each unit. Awarding City & Guilds of London Institute Created 20150415 12:24:21 Updated 20150415 12:24:21
